Crystal Form Transition during Heating of Solvent-induced Crystalline Syndiotactic Polystyrene

         

摘要

The phase transition of two kinds of solvent-induced crystalline syndiotactic polystyrene (sPS) , γ-sPS and δe-sPS, has been studied via WAXD and DSC. γ-sPS transform to α-sPS at 195-225℃ before melt during heating, whereas δe-sPS transform to first γ-sPS and then α-sPS at 100-200℃ and 200-215℃, respectively. The transition of δe-γ and γ-α occurs far below melting point of sPS indicates they are all solid-solid transition.
